Jane Blade's Gift from a Goddess open challenge



It was William Lyons who answered Jane Blade’s Gift From a Goddess open challenge. The match started off well enough, Jane Blade made no attempts to leave the match early. She actually wrestled and did it well despite her larger opponent. Unfortunately for her, her larger opponent would start to take control of the rest of the match. Lyons uses his bigger frame to toss around the cousin of John Blade. He picks her up Irish Whips her and catches her with a battering ram of a shoulder tackle on the rebound. The dazed Jane Blade rolls out of the ring and draws a count out to a chorus of boos

Winner: William Lyons
Near Falls: Lyon(0), Blade(0)
Finishing Move: N/A
Match Length: 6:32

BJR vs. Alex Garrett vs. Kendra O'Hurn

All three of these competitors combined for very exciting and fast paced match. Bell to bell it was high octane, and there was points in the match where any one of the three could have taken the victory and gone on to the number one contenders match next week. Garrett ended up the victor when he gave O’Hurn a stiff enziguri which sent her falling down off her perch on the top rope and obviously preventing her from hitting Beautiful Letdown on to The Moderator. Instead it was Alex Garrett who would hit his own Flying Elbow Drop, Hammer to Fall. Securing a pin fall and his spot in the number one contenders match next show.

Winner: Alex Garrett
Near Falls: Garrett(2), BJR(3), O’Hurns(2)
Finishing Move: Hammer to Fall
Match Length: 13:51

Yoji Kojima w/ Chris Constantine vs. Kendrick Warwick

Warwick came into the this match with everyone doubting her abilities. Even though she wasn’t able to overcome Kojima in the end, she silenced many of those doubters with a great performance. Even almost getting the victory at one point after hitting Goalpost Junction on her opponent. Kojima continued his run of fantastic performances and despite the toughness and heart of Warwick, he soldiered on through not showing signs of frustration like he has in past situation. After hitting his myriad of suplexs he would hit his signature Gaijin Killer manuver. After the match he held the Ultimate Championship up high in the air with Constantine in the background.

Winner: Yoji Kojima
Near Falls: Yoji Kojima(4), Kendall Warwick(1)
Finishing Move: Gaijin Killer
Match Length: 11:56

Adam Sinclair vs. Momoko Honda vs. Hanna Akana

Much like last match this match was also very fast paced. Throughout the entire match the work of Momoko Honda was shining through. She looked very impressive as she bounced around the ring attacking her opponents, and there was several moments in the match where she almost had the victory. Honda’s downfall was the fact that Adam Sinclair has just a little bit more experience and was able to reverse Earth Quaker and follow up that reversal with From London With Love to score the pinfall on Honda. After the match Alex Garrett steps back into the ring to stand nose to nose with his opponent next week.

Winner: Adam Sinclair
Near Fall: Momoko Honda(6), Adam Sinclair(3), Hanna Akana(2)
Finishing Move: From London With Love
Match Length: 14:34

Jordan Parker Kane & Sachin Pereira vs. &Co

Jordan Parker’s mystery partner was revealed to be Sachin Pereira much to the crowds glee. Following suit with many of the other matches on the show this match was fast and furious despite the various early miscommunications on the part of Sachin Pereira and Jordan Parker. It was the miscommunications which almost garnered &Co and victory several times over the course of the early goings. As the match wore on Parker and Pereira started to work with each other, quick tags, elaborate double teams, the whole nine yards. The non-battle royal debut performance of Jordan Parker took center stage in this match as well. He looked simply magnificent in the way he attacked and moved, and he topped off his performance with his picturesque finishing maneuvers called Spidey Sense.

Winner: Jordan Parker and Sachin Pereira
Near Falls: Jordan Parker and Sachin Pereira(2), &Co(5)
Finishing Move: Spidey Sense
Match Length: 16:45
